§ 6306. Authority to vest title in tangible personal property for research

The head of an executive agency may vest title in tangible personal property in a nonprofit institution of higher education or in a nonprofit organization whose primary purpose is conducting scientific research—

  • (1) when the property is bought with amounts provided under a procurement contract, grant agreement, or cooperative agreement with the institution or organization to conduct basic or applied scientific research;
  • (2) when the head of the agency decides the vesting furthers the objectives of the agency;
  • (3) without further obligation to the United States Government; and
  • (4) under conditions the head of the agency considers appropriate.
